DESCRIPTION¶
The
tcl::chan::random package provides a command creating random
channels, i.e. read-only channels which return an infinite stream of
pseudo-random characters upon reading. This is similar to the random channels
provided by the package
Memchan, except that this is written in pure
Tcl, not C, and uses a much simpler generator as well. On the other hand,
Memchan is usable with Tcl 8.4 and before, whereas this package
requires Tcl 8.5 or higher, and TclOO.
The internal
TclOO class implementing the channel handler is a sub-class
of the
tcl::chan::events framework.
API¶
- ::tcl::chan::random seed
- This command creates a new random channel and returns its handle. The seed
is a list of integer numbers used to initialize the internal feedback
shift register of the generator.
